Understanding the German B1 Certificate: A Gateway to Advanced Language Proficiency
The German B1 Certificate, typically described as the "Zertifikat Deutsch B1," is a considerable milestone for students of the German language. This certification, which is part of the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R), signifies a level of efficiency that enables individuals to communicate effectively in a large range of daily and expert scenarios. This short article looks into the importance of the B1 certificate, the assessment process, and pointers for preparation.
What is the German B1 Certificate?
The German B1 Certificate is a globally recognized language credentials that vouches for a learner's ability to comprehend and use German in a variety of contexts. At the B1 level, people can:
Understand the bottom lines of clear basic input on familiar matters routinely come across in work, school, leisure, and so on.Handle many circumstances likely to develop while taking a trip in an area where the language is spoken.Produce simple connected text on subjects that are familiar or of individual interest.Describe experiences and occasions, dreams, hopes, and aspirations, and briefly offer reasons and descriptions for viewpoints and strategies.Importance of the B1 Certificate
Educational Opportunities: The B1 certificate is often a prerequisite for admission to German universities and other college institutions. It shows to admissions committees that the applicant has a sufficient command of the German language to follow the curriculum and take part in scholastic discussions.

Expert Advancement: In the professional world, the B1 certificate can open doors to task opportunities in German-speaking nations or international companies. It reveals employers that the candidate can communicate efficiently in a company environment and deal with regular jobs in German.

Cultural Integration: For people planning to live in Germany or other German-speaking nations, the B1 certificate is a valuable tool for incorporating into the local community. It allows them to engage in social activities, comprehend cultural nuances, and build relationships with native speakers.

Personal Fulfillment: Achieving the B1 level is a substantial personal accomplishment. It improves self-confidence and supplies a sense of accomplishment, motivating learners to continue their language journey.
The Examination Process
The German B1 Certificate examination is developed to assess the prospect's efficiency in all 4 language abilities: reading, writing, listening, and speaking. The test is normally divided into the following sections:

Reading Comprehension:
Format: Candidates read a series of texts and respond to multiple-choice questions.Abilities Assessed: Ability to understand and interpret written info, consisting of short articles, letters, and narratives.
Writing:
Format: Candidates compose a brief essay or letter based upon a given timely.Skills Assessed: Ability to reveal ideas clearly and coherently in written type, with right grammar and vocabulary.
Listening:
Format: Candidates listen to audio recordings and respond to questions based on what they hear.Skills Assessed: Ability to comprehend spoken German in numerous contexts, consisting of discussions, statements, and interviews.
Speaking:
Format: Candidates take part in a structured conversation with an examiner.Skills Assessed: Ability to communicate effectively in spoken German, consisting of revealing opinions, asking and addressing concerns, and explaining scenarios.Preparation Tips
Practice Regularly: Consistent practice is key to improving language abilities. Engage in activities that include all 4 language skills, such as checking out German books, composing journal entries, listening to German podcasts, and speaking with native speakers.

Use Authentic Materials: Incorporate authentic materials into your study routine, such as German newspapers, publications, and television shows. This will assist you end up being acquainted with real-world language usage.

Take Practice Tests: Familiarize yourself with the format and types of concerns in the B1 evaluation by taking practice tests. Many resources are available online, and language schools frequently provide mock exams.

Sign Up With a Language Course: Enroll in a German language course to get structured guidance and feedback from skilled trainers. Group classes likewise offer opportunities to practice speaking with peers.

Broaden Your Vocabulary: Build a robust vocabulary by discovering brand-new words and expressions routinely. Use flashcards, apps, or a vocabulary notebook to track your development.

Look for Feedback: Regularly seek feedback on your speaking and composing abilities from native speakers or language tutors. This will assist you determine areas for improvement and fine-tune your language usage.
FAQs
Q: How long does it require to prepare for the B1 examination?

A: The time required to prepare for the B1 examination differs depending upon the person's starting level and the intensity of their study. Generally, it can take several months of constant practice to reach the B1 level.

Q: Can I retake the B1 evaluation if I stop working?

A: Yes, you can retake the B1 examination if you do not pass. It is recommended to identify the locations where you need enhancement and concentrate on those before retaking the test.

Q: Are there various versions of the B1 certificate for different functions?

A: Yes, there are various variations of the B1 certificate, such as the "Zertifikat Deutsch B1" for basic purposes, the "Zertifikat Deutsch B1: Beruf" for expert contexts, and the "Zertifikat Deutsch B1: Gesundheitswesen" for healthcare experts.

Q: Is the B1 certificate legitimate for life?

A: The B1 certificate is usually considered valid for life, but some institutions might need you to take a brand-new test if a considerable quantity of time has actually passed since your preliminary accreditation.

Q: Can I use the B1 certificate for visa applications?

A: Yes, the B1 certificate is often accepted as evidence of language efficiency for visa applications to German-speaking countries. However, it is always suggested to examine the specific requirements of the embassy or consulate.
